Indonesia - Jakarta

Jakarta is located on the northwest coast of Java, at the mouth of the Ciliwung River on Jakarta Bay, which is an inlet of the Java Sea. Officially, the area of the Jakarta Special District is 662 km2 (256 sq mi) of land area and 6,977 km2 (2,694 sq mi) of sea area. The Thousand Islands, which are administratively a part of Jakarta, are located in Jakarta Bay, north of the city.

Mount Bromo (IndonesianGunung Bromo), is an active volcano and part of the Tengger massif, in East JavaIndonesia. At 2,329 metres (7,641 ft) it is not the highest peak of the massif, but is the most well known.
